Amulet with cuneiform inscription against the female demon Lamashtu who was said to cause puerperal feaver. Reverse. Neo-Babylonian, 1st half 1st millennium BCE. Black stone, 6.9 x 5.4 cm. Inv. VA 03477. Photo: Jürgen Liepe. 
Location Vorderasiatisches Museum/Staatliche Museen/Berlin/Germany
